What Are the Challenges in Using Graph-Based Representations?
Despite their advantages, there are several challenges in using graph-based representations in nanotechnology:
Scalability: As the size and complexity of the system increase, the computational resources required for graph-based analyses can become prohibitive. Accuracy: Simplifying assumptions made during graph construction may lead to loss of important details, affecting the accuracy of the model. Integration: Combining graph-based models with other analytical techniques and ensuring consistency can be challenging.
